The #Hyades cluster is the 2nd- closest star cluster to Earth, at a distance of 150 light-years. This compact V-shaped cluster is easy to spot in the night sky. It's the Face of Taurus the Bull. Read more at: buff.ly/MNzwvbz

🏛️ According to our Greek mythology, the #Hyades ✨ were a group of five nymphs associated with rain and fertility. They were daughters of Atlas and Aethra, often linked to the constellation that heralded the rainy season.

The #Hyades is the nearest open #starcluster, located in #Taurus, approx. 153 ly away.
